你查询的IP:[114.80.75.138]  地理位置:中国–上海–上海电信/IDC机房

最新查询202.38.195.43 202.120.191.9 121.89.14.234 119.60.132.4 116.52.87.198 118.84.28.231 116.52.90.173 221.136.115.1 121.208.16.165 114.80.75.138 122.102.39.45 202.192.92.69 220.101.192.252 202.123.96.200 221.8.187.137 125.171.62.80 222.16.83.76 210.76.38.3 116.95.221.209 203.128.32.241 123.177.78.163 203.100.192.26 202.120.67.187 118.180.142.122 220.231.38.178 60.200.181.61 121.156.16.211 61.8.160.193 210.51.232.250 203.81.16.173 119.40.64.211